Migrated from SME 7.5 and Sail 2.5, followed Docs for upgrade all goes fine and database migration from V2 scripts runs, first step detection regen/init of PCI cards works ok but on doing the commit results in following error message:
DBD::SQLite::db do failed: table lineIO has no column named channel(1) at dbdimp.c line 271 at /usr/lib/perl5/site_perl/sark/SarkSubs.pm line 1147, <IN> line 9
Have tried removing sail V3 and /home/sark/db and reinstalled with signal-event post-upgrade ;signal-event reboots.
Software Versions
SME 8b5 uptodate
Sail 3.0.0.36
PCI Cards Detected
usb:001/002 xpp_usb- e4e4:1151 Astribank-multi USB-firmware
pci:0000:06:00.0 wctdm+ e159:0001 Wildcard TDM400P REV E/F
/etc/dahdi/system.conf
# Autogenerated by /usr/sbin/dahdi_genconf on Sat Jul 17 12:35:28 2010
# If you edit this file and execute /usr/sbin/dahdi_genconf again,
# your manual changes will be LOST.
# Dahdi Configuration File
#
# This file is parsed by the Dahdi Configurator, dahdi_cfg
#
# Span 1: WCTDM/4 "Wildcard TDM400P REV E/F Board 5" (MASTER)
fxsks=1
echocanceller=mg2,1
fxsks=2
echocanceller=mg2,2
fxsks=3
echocanceller=mg2,3
fxsks=4
echocanceller=mg2,4
# Global data
loadzone = us
defaultzone = us
/etc/dahdi/dahdi-channels
; Autogenerated by /usr/sbin/dahdi_genconf on Sat Jul 17 12:35:28 2010
; If you edit this file and execute /usr/sbin/dahdi_genconf again,
; your manual changes will be LOST.
; Dahdi Channels Configurations (chan_dahdi.conf)
;
; This is not intended to be a complete chan_dahdi.conf. Rather, it is intended
; to be #include-d by /etc/chan_dahdi.conf that will include the global settings
;
; Span 1: WCTDM/4 "Wildcard TDM400P REV E/F Board 5" (MASTER)
;;; line="1 WCTDM/4/0 FXSKS"
signalling=fxs_ks
callerid=asreceived
group=0
context=from-pstn
channel => 1
callerid=
group=
context=default
;;; line="2 WCTDM/4/1 FXSKS"
signalling=fxs_ks
callerid=asreceived
group=0
context=from-pstn
channel => 2
callerid=
group=
context=default
;;; line="3 WCTDM/4/2 FXSKS"
signalling=fxs_ks
callerid=asreceived
group=0
context=from-pstn
channel => 3
callerid=
group=
context=default
;;; line="4 WCTDM/4/3 FXSKS"
signalling=fxs_ks
callerid=asreceived
group=0
context=from-pstn
channel => 4
callerid=
group=
context=default